Description

Şehidiye Madrasa is an important educational structure located within the historical fabric of Mardin, dating back to the Artuqid period, and notable for its distinctive architecture.

Story

Rising amidst the narrow, history-laden streets and stone buildings of Mardin, Şehidiye Madrasa stands as a significant monument testifying to the city's deep-rooted past. Known to have been built towards the end of the Artuqid period, in the late 14th century, this madrasa particularly draws attention with its mihrab niche and distinctive minaret. Also referred to as Marufiye Madrasa in some sources, Şehidiye Madrasa served as one of the important centers of knowledge and education of its era. The structure boasts a simple yet impressive architecture, constructed from cut stone, reflecting Mardin's geographical and cultural characteristics. The student rooms and classrooms arranged around the madrasa's courtyard transport the learning atmosphere of the past to the present day. Carrying the characteristic features of Artuqid architecture, the madrasa captivates visitors especially with its finely crafted monumental portal on the southern facade and its geometric decorations. The mihrab inside is a rare example where stone craftsmanship combines aesthetic and religious symbols. One of the most striking features of the madrasa is its minaret, which contributes uniquely to Mardin's skyline. Unlike other madrasa minarets, it has an original design with a cylindrical body resting on a square base and muqarnas details beneath the balcony (şerefe). Beyond being merely an architectural structure, Şehidiye Madrasa is an important part of Mardin's cultural identity and scientific tradition.
